HCG 9330 - Interdisciplinary Research

Institution:
Clemson University
Subject:
Health Care Genetics
Description:
Examination of interdisciplinary research as a means of integrating information, data, techniques, tools, perspectives, concepts and/or theories from two or more disciplines or bodies of specialized knowledge in order to advance knowledge development or solve problems. Preq: Doctoral standing or consent of instructor.
